Care & Share serves qualifying residents of Erie County, Ohio fairly and with dignity. The agency provides supplemental and emergency food (once per month) through the food pantry, clothing, linens, and housewares as available. Please visit during operating hours for additional information.

The Crisis Program operates a Crisis Hotline that provides phone support and referrals 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. The Crisis Hotline is staffed by specially trained Behavioral Health professionals who provide callers with immediate and confidential assistance.
